Mill Type Overview. Three types of mill design are common. The Overflow Discharge mill is best suited for fine grinding to 75 – 106 microns.; The Diaphram or Grate Discharge mill keeps coarse particles within the mill for additional grinding and typically used for grinds to 150 – 250 microns.; The CenterPeriphery Discharge mill has feed reporting from both ends and the product discharges ...

Ball mill. A typical type of fine grinder is the ball slightly inclined or horizontal rotating cylinder is partially filled with balls, usually stone or metal, which grind material to the necessary fineness by friction and impact with the tumbling balls. Ball mills normally operate with an approximate ball charge of 30%.

Calculation of energy required for grinding in a ball mill. Int. J. Miner. Process., 25: 4146. The Bond work index, Wi, as an indicator of the grindability of raw materials is not a material constant but rather it changes with change of size of the grinding product.
